Answer: Developing an app for Android TV version 9 (API 28) involves configuring an Android Studio project with a Leanback launcher activity, designing a 10-foot user interface optimized for D-pad navigation, and declaring TV-specific hardware requirements in the manifest.
To build an app specifically targeting Android TV version 9 (API Level 28), you must start by setting up your development environment in Android Studio. Create a new project and configure your build.gradle file, setting the minSdkVersion to 28 (or lower if you want broader backward compatibility) and the targetSdkVersion to 28 or higher. The most critical step lies in configuring the AndroidManifest.xml to signify that this is a TV app. You must declare that a touchscreen is not required by adding <uses-feature android:name="android.hardware.touchscreen" android:required="false" />. Additionally, you must declare support for the Leanback UI by adding <uses-feature android:name="android.software.leanback" android:required="true" />. Finally, designate your main TV activity by adding an intent-filter containing the <category android:name="android.intent.category.LEANBACK_LAUNCHER" /> tag. Designing for the '10-foot user interface' is vital. Android TV users navigate using a D-pad remote control rather than a touchscreen. Therefore, you must ensure that all interactive UI elements are clearly focusable and have visible selected states. While modern apps are moving toward Jetpack Compose for TV, the Android Leanback UI toolkit remains highly robust and fully compatible with API 28, offering pre-built templates for media browsing and playback. Before publishing, rigorously test your application. You can set up an Android Virtual Device (AVD) running Android TV (API 28) in Android Studio, or connect a physical Android TV device via ADB (Android Debug Bridge). Make sure your app conforms to Google's Android TV App Quality guidelines, focusing on proper aspect ratios, banner assets, and D-pad navigation flow.

Answer: To make an app for Android TV version 9, build a native Android app in Android Studio using Kotlin or Java, target Android 9/API 28 or higher, and add Android TV-specific manifest, UI, and remote-control support.
Start by installing Android Studio and creating a new Android project. Use Kotlin if you are starting fresh, because it is the recommended language for modern Android development. Set your app to support Android 9 by configuring the SDK versions in your Gradle file. Android 9 is API level 28, so your app should have `targetSdk` 28 or higher, and `minSdk` should be low enough for the devices you want to support. For Android TV, you must declare TV support in `AndroidManifest.xml`. Add a Leanback launcher intent so the app appears on Android TV, and mark touchscreen as not required because TV devices usually use a remote, not touch input. Example manifest parts: ```xml <uses-feature android:name="android.hardware.touchscreen" android:required="false" /> <uses-feature android:name="android.software.leanback" android:required="true" /> <application android:banner="@drawable/banner"> <activity android:name=".MainActivity" android:exported="true"> <intent-filter> <action android:name="android.intent.action.MAIN" /> <category android:name="android.intent.category.LEANBACK_LAUNCHER" /> </intent-filter> </activity> </application> ``` Design the app for TV screens, not phones. Use large text, simple navigation, clear focus states, and layouts that work from about 10 feet away. Every button, card, and menu item should be usable with a D-pad remote. You can build the interface using regular Android views, Jetpack Compose, or the AndroidX Leanback library. Leanback is useful for classic TV layouts such as rows of movie cards, details pages, and playback screens. Test the app using an Android TV emulator in Android Studio. Create a virtual device such as Android TV with API 28, then test navigation using keyboard arrow keys or a remote-control emulator. If your app plays video, use ExoPlayer/Media3. If it streams content, make sure you handle buffering, network errors, subtitles, playback controls, and focus behavior correctly. Finally, generate a signed APK or Android App Bundle, test it on a real Android TV 9 device if possible, and publish it through Google Play Console with Android TV screenshots, banner image, and TV-compatible metadata.

Answer: To build an Android TV app for Android 9 (API level 28), use Android Studio with the Leanback support library, set minSdkVersion to 28, and follow the TV-specific UI and input guidelines.
Here is a step-by-step path to create an Android TV app targeting Android 9 (Pie, API 28): 1. Set up the environment: Install the latest Android Studio, then via the SDK Manager install the Android 9 (API 28) SDK platform and the Android TV system image for emulator testing. 2. Create the project: In Android Studio choose File > New > New Project > TV > Android TV Activity. This scaffolds a project with the Leanback library, a BrowseFragment, and the required TV manifest entries. In build.gradle set: - compileSdk 28 (or higher; you can compile against newer SDKs while still supporting 9) - minSdkVersion 28 if you specifically target Android 9 and above (or lower, e.g. 21, if you want broader TV compatibility — Android TV started at API 21) - targetSdkVersion 28 if you want to target Pie specifically. 3. Configure the manifest for TV: - Declare `<uses-feature android:name="android.software.leanback" android:required="true"/>` - Declare `<uses-feature android:name="android.hardware.touchscreen" android:required="false"/>` - Your main activity must include the `android.intent.category.LEANBACK_LAUNCHER` intent filter so it shows up on the TV home screen. - Provide a banner image (320x180 xhdpi) via `android:banner` on the application or activity tag. 4. Add Leanback dependencies in build.gradle: - `implementation 'androidx.leanback:leanback:1.0.0'` - Optionally `androidx.leanback:leanback-preference` and `androidx.tvprovider:tvprovider` for channels/recommendations. 5. Build the UI with Leanback components: Use `BrowseSupportFragment` for the main browse experience, `RowsSupportFragment`, `ListRow`, `Presenter`/`CardPresenter` for content cards, and `DetailsSupportFragment` for item details. Design for the 10-foot experience: large fonts, high contrast, generous spacing, and full D-pad navigability (every focusable view must be reachable and have a visible focus state). 6. Handle media playback: For video apps use ExoPlayer with `PlaybackSupportFragment` and a `PlaybackTransportControlGlue`. Implement proper MediaSession integration so the remote's play/pause/next keys work. 7. Input handling: Test exclusively with the D-pad (KEYCODE_DPAD_UP/DOWN/LEFT/RIGHT/CENTER, BACK, MENU). Never assume touch input. Avoid web-style scrolling; use focus-driven navigation. 8. Test on Android 9: Create an AVD using the Android TV (1080p) device profile with the API 28 system image, or sideload to a real Android TV box running Pie via ADB over network (`adb connect <tv-ip>:5555`, then `adb install app.apk`). 9. Optional but recommended: Add a Home Screen Channel using the TvProvider API so your app surfaces content on the launcher, and implement global search via a SearchManager content provider. 10. Publish: Build a signed APK or App Bundle and submit through Google Play Console, opting in to the Android TV distribution and passing the TV quality checklist (D-pad navigation, banner, leanback launcher, no touch dependence).
